Update on Ticket Sales for Tonight’s AEW Dynamite + Collision in Philadelphia
Image Credit: AEW
An update on ticket sales for tonight’s episode of AEW Dynamite + Collision.
AEW will present a three-hour special episode, two hours of Dynamite followed by one hour of Collision, from the Liacouras Center in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ania.
According to the latest update from WrestleTix [via Wrestling Observer], the company has sold 3,535 tickets for the show as of this morning. The cheapest ticket is listed at $40.30.
The last time All Elite Wrestling ran a show from the venue, i.e., Dynasty 2025, it garnered 7,921 fans. The most recent weekly show, i.e., the November 2, 2024, edition of Collision, drew 2,842 fans. The venue last hosted Wednesday Night Dynamite in October 2023 and attracted 5,673 fans.
Tonight’s episode will feature newly crowned AEW World Champion MJF’s championship celebration segment, a Lights Out Philly Street Fight between former Women’s World Champions Kris Statlander and Hikaru Shida, Jericho vs. Ricochet, and more.
